Episode Summary
In this deeply moving episode of The Audacious Living Podcast, Audley Stephenson sits down with author and resilience coach Naseem Rochette, whose life changed forever after being run over by a car—three times. What followed wasn’t just physical recovery, but a profound emotional and spiritual transformation.
Naseem shares how trauma reshaped her identity, her relationships, and her understanding of strength. Drawing from the Japanese philosophy of Kintsugi, she explains how embracing our cracks can become the very source of our power. Together, Audley and Naseem explore healing, gratitude, storytelling, and the courage it takes to choose growth after devastation.
This conversation is a powerful reminder that while we may not choose our hardships, we can choose how we rise from them.

Guest Bio
Naseem Rochette is an author, speaker, and resilience coach whose life was forever changed after surviving a devastating accident. Through her book The Unexpected Benefits of Being Run Over, she shares her journey of recovery, identity, and post-traumatic growth. Her work centers on helping others reframe adversity, embrace vulnerability, and rediscover joy after hardship.
She is also the creator of Unbreakable Day, a powerful annual reminder that healing is a process worth honoring.
